User-plane service degradation via unbounded GTP-U processing
Published May 9, 2026 · Updated May 9, 2026
Resource consumption in Open5GS UPF 2.7.0 through 2.7.7 allows remote attackers to degrade user-plane service via GTP-U traffic. The _gtpv1_u_recv_cb hot path performs synchronous logging, packet hexdumps, and protocol responses for each Echo Request or unknown TEID without rate limiting. Exploitation requires sustained high-rate access to the UPF GTP-U endpoint and increases latency and packet loss; the upstream project disputes that the behavior is a bug.
